About Shengnan Li

Shengnan Li is a scholar working on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ality,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ty and Aerospace Engineering, having authored 45 papers that have together received 388 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Combustion and Detonation Processes (16 papers), Fire dynamics and safety research (14 papers) and Coal Properties and Utilization (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(140 citations),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(78 citations) and Aerospace Engineering (182 citations). Shengnan Li has collaborated with scholars based in China, Singapore and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Ke Gao, Jinzhang Jia, Xiaoqi Wang, Yan Yan, Zhipeng Qi, Ke Gao, Hehao Niu, Zimeng Liu, Daoxing Guo and Bangning Zhang.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Scientific Reports.
